  • Patent number: 10166972
    Abstract: A controller is provided for a parallel hybrid electric vehicle. The vehicle powertrain includes an engine, an electric propulsion motor powered by an energy storage device, and an electric generator driven by the engine to recharge the energy storage device. The controller receives one or more signals indicative of one or more operating modes in which the vehicle is to be operated; receives a signal indicative of demanded powertrain drive torque; and causes the engine and electric propulsion motor to deliver drive torque to one or more wheels to drive the vehicle. The controller causes the powertrain to operate in a parallel powertrain mode, where the amount of torque delivered by the electric propulsion motor is determined by the controller in dependence on the signal indicative of demanded powertrain drive torque and the one or more signals indicative of the one or more operating modes.
